TUCKER, Ga. - Rafael Rivera was named Manager, Food Safety and Production Programs for the US Poultry & Egg Association (USPOULTRY). His responsibilities include developing on-going programs addressing major regulatory and technical challenges facing poultry operations.

“We are excited to welcome Rafael to our organization. We are confident his strong food-safety background will enhance USPOULTRY’s ability to serve the industry,” said John Starkey, USPOULTRY president.

Before joining USPOULTRY, Rivera worked for Perdue Farms where he was flock supervisor, HACCP coordinator and quality assurance supervisor. Rivera holds a bachelor of science in animal science degree from the Univ. of Puerto Rico and a master of science in poultry science degree from North Carolina State Univ.

“I am pleased to join the USPOULTRY team. USPOULTRY is made up of professionals in their fields who are committed to supporting the poultry industry,” Rivera said.
